The San Francisco Giants are 52-44 this season. They are 3rd in the NL West.

Scores & Schedules

See schedule

2025 Division Standings

TEAM W L PCT GB
Dodgers Dodgers
57
39
.594
Padres Padres
52
43
.547
4.5
Giants Giants
52
44
.542
5.0
Diamondbacks Diamondbacks
46
50
.479
11.0
Rockies Rockies
22
73
.232
34.5

2025 Batting Stats

See stats
G AB R H 2B 3B HR RBI BB HBP SO SB CS AVG OBP SLG
Team
96
3,146
397
725
144
17
88
377
338
40
812
45
17
.230
.311
.371
Team Rank
28th
20th
28th
20th
5th
25th
21st
4th
12th
19th
27th
9th
26th
21st
27th

2025 Pitching Stats

See stats
G W L ERA SO SHO SV IP H ER R HR BB HBP
Team
96
52
44
3.50
816
0
26
848.2
765
330
377
83
299
31
Team Rank
10th
11th
2nd
9th
8th
9th
12th
13th
2nd
7th
1st
12th
7th

MLB 2025 Batting Leaders

MLB 2025 Pitching Leaders

MLB Fantasy 2025

MLB 2025 Betting

MLB 2025 Division Standings

AL East W L PCT GB
Blue Jays Blue Jays
55
40
.579
Yankees Yankees
53
42
.558
2.0
AL Central W L PCT GB
Tigers Tigers
59
37
.615
Twins Twins
47
48
.495
11.5
AL West W L PCT GB
Astros Astros
56
39
.589
Mariners Mariners
50
45
.526
6.0
NL East W L PCT GB
Mets Mets
55
41
.573
Phillies Phillies
54
41
.568
0.5
NL Central W L PCT GB
Cubs Cubs
56
39
.589
Brewers Brewers
55
40
.579
1.0
NL West W L PCT GB
Dodgers Dodgers
57
39
.594
Padres Padres
52
43
.547
4.5

MLB 2025 Scores & Schedule

Scores

DATE MATCHUP SCORE
Fri
6/27
MIN MIN
@
DET DET
5-10
Fri
6/27
NYM NYM
@
PIT PIT
2-9
Fri
6/27
TBR TBR
@
BAL BAL
11-3
Fri
6/27
SEA SEA
@
TEX TEX
2-3
Fri
6/27
LAD LAD
@
KCR KCR
5-9

Schedule

DATE MATCHUP TIME (ET)
Sun
7/13
ATL ATL
@
STL STL
2:15 PM
Sun
7/13
LAD LAD
@
SFG SFG
4:05 PM
Sun
7/13
TOR TOR
@
ATH ATH
4:05 PM
Sun
7/13
AZ AZ
@
LAA LAA
4:07 PM
Sun
7/13
PHI PHI
@
SDP SDP
4:10 PM